The most striking addition is the "Burn Time" mechanic. A small grainy timer appears in the bottom-right corner during pivotal dialogue choices. If you fail to select an option within 8 seconds, the game auto-selects the most aggressive response. This single-handedly turned slow readers into reluctant perpetrators of in-game violence, a design choice that remains controversial.
